WebAug 28, 2024 · Results: Each of the evaluated HbA1c methods had CVs <3% in SI units and <2% in NGSP units at 46 mmol/mol (6.4%) and 72 mmol/mol (8.7%) and passed the NGSP criteria when compared with six secondary reference measurement procedures (SRMPs). Sigma was 8.6 for Abbott Enzymatic, 3.3 for Roche Cobas c513 and 6.9 for … WebNov 14, 2012 · The publication called for HbA 1c results to be reported worldwide in IFCC units (mmol/mol) and derived NGSP units (%), using the IFCC-NGSP master equation. A subsequent publication appeared 3 years later ( 47 ) and reiterated that HbA 1c results should be reported by clinical laboratories worldwide in SI and derived NGSP units.

WebJan 15, 2024 · HbA1c can be expressed as a percentage (DCCT unit) or as a value in mmol/mol (IFCC unit). Since 2009, mmol/mol has been the default unit to use in the UK.
